《手把手教你学MCS51单片机》.rar 源程序 383.31 KB

4星(超过85%的资源)
所需积分/C币:43 2009-08-11 23:33:46 383KB APPLICATION/X-RAR
125
收藏 收藏
举报

《手把手教你学MCS51单片机》源码 的配套书的目录 第1章 实验设备及器材使用介绍 1.1 单片机的发展史及特点1 1.2 单片机入门的有效途径2 1.3 实验工具及器材3 1.3.1 Keil C51 Windows集成开发环境3 1.3.2 TOP851多功能编程器4 1.3.3 LED输出试验板5 1.3.4 LED数码管输出试验板6 1.3.5 5V高稳定专用稳压电源8 1.3.6 16×2字符型液晶显示模组8 第2章 Keil C51集成开发环境及TOP851多功能编程器 2.1 Keil C51集成开发环境软件安装10 2.2 TOP851烧录软件安装11 2.3 TOP851烧录软件操作12 2.3.1 文件操作和编辑12 2.3.2 选择型号16 2.3.3 读/写单片机17 第3章 初步接触KeilC51及TOP851软件并感受第一个演示程序效果 3.1 建立一个工程项目,选择芯片并确定选项19 3.2 建立源程序文件21 3.3 添加文件到当前项目组中22 3.4 编译(汇编)文件23 3,5 检查并修改源程序文件中的错误24 3.6 软件模拟仿真调试24 3.7 烧录程序(编程操作)25 3.8 观察程序运行的结果27 第4章 单片机的基本知识 4.1 MCS51单片机的基本结构28 4.2 80C51基本特性及引脚定义29 4.2.1 80C51的基本特征29 4.2.2 80C51的引脚定义及功能30 4.3 80C51的内部结构31 4.4 80C51的存储器配置和寄存器33 第5章 汇编语言程序指令的学习 5.1 MCS51单片机的指令系统37 5.2 汇编语言的特点38 5.3 汇编语言的语句格式38 第6章 数据传送指令的学习及实验 6.1 按寻址方式分类的数据传送指令40 6.1.1 立即数寻址40 6.1.2 直接寻址40 6.1.3 寄存器寻址40 6.1.4 寄存器间接寻址40 6.1.5 位寻址41 6.1.6 变址寻址41 6.1.7 相对寻址41 6.2 点亮/熄灭一个发光二极管的实验,自动循环工作41 6.2.1 实现方法41 6.2.2 源程序文件41 6.2.3 程序分析解释43 6.2.4 小结43 6.3 点亮/熄灭一个发光二极管的实验,点亮/熄灭时间自动发生变化(分3段),自动循环工作43 6.3.1 实现方法43 6.3.2 源程序文件44 6.3.3 程序分析解释45 6.3.4 小结45 6.4 P1口的8个发光二极管每隔2个右循环点亮实验46 6.4.1 实现方法46 6.4.2 源程序文件46 6.4.3 程序分析解释46 6.4.4 小结47 6.5 MCS51内部的RAM和特殊功能寄存器SFR的数据传送指令47 6.5.1 以累加器为目的操作数47 6.5.2 以寄存器为目的操作数47 6.5.3 以直接地址为目的操作数47 6.5.4 以寄存器间接地址为目的操作数48 6.5.5 16位数据传送48 6.6 “跑马灯”实验 48 6.6.1 实现方法48 6.6.2 源程序文件49 6.6.3 程序分析解释51 6.6.4 小结53 6.7 单片机的受控输出显示实验53 6.7.1 实现方法53 6.7.2 源程序文件53 6.7.3 程序分析解释54 6.8 小结55 第7章 算术运算指令的学习及实验 7.1 算术运算指令56 7.1.1 加法指令56 7.1.2 带进位加法指令56 7.1.3 带借位减法指令56 7.1.4 乘法指令57 7.1.5 除法指令57 7.1.6 加1指令57 7.1.7 减1指令57 7.1.8 二十进制调整指令58 7.2 52H、FCH两数相加实验,结果从P1口输出58 7.2.1 实现方法58 7.2.2 源程序文件58 7.2.3 程序分析解释59 7.3 FFH、03H两数相乘实验,结果从P0、P1口输出60 7.3.1 实现方法60 7.3.2 源程序文件60 7.3.3 程序分析解释61 7.4 加1指令实验,让P1口的8个发光二极管模拟二进制的加法运算61 7.4.1 实现方法61 7.4.2 源程序文件61 7.4.3 程序分析解释62 7.5 加1指令实验(不进行二十进制调整)62 7.5.1 实现方法62 7.5.2 源程序文件63 7.5.3 程序分析解释64 7.6 加1指令实验(进行二十进制调整)64 7.6.1 实现方法64 7.6.2 源程序文件64 7.6.3 程序分析解释65 7.7 小结66 第8章 逻辑运算指令的学习及实验 8.1 逻辑运算指令67 8.1.1 累加器A取反指令67 8.1.2 累加器A清0指令67 8.1.3 逻辑“与”指令67 8.1.4 逻辑“或”指令

...展开详情
立即下载
限时抽奖 低至0.43元/次
身份认证后 购VIP低至7折
一个资源只可评论一次,评论内容不能少于5个字
vonrejean 程序是汇编写的还可以
2015-09-24
回复
ATPX 真的很好,刚好配合图书馆借来的书
2013-10-23
回复
janelack 在51单片机里面算不错了
2013-10-11
回复
justinsteven 没用的东西,内容不完整,很多章节都没有。 最重要的是,程序是汇编写的,而且没有注释!
2013-05-17
回复
源_程序 看似比较好,但是不适合我等初学者看
2012-10-19
回复
您会向同学/朋友/同事推荐我们的CSDN下载吗?
谢谢参与!您的真实评价是我们改进的动力~
  • 分享王者

关注 私信
上传资源赚钱or赚积分
最新推荐
《手把手教你学MCS51单片机》.rar 源程序 383.31 KB 43积分/C币 立即下载
1/0